Re: Cyrus - unable to create pop3 listener socket



On 31-Oct-07, at 12:35 PM, Wayne wrote:

I've been running Cyrus IMAP for quite a while and have decided to add
POP3 services as well.  I uncommented the line in /etc/cyrus.conf

  pop3          cmd="pop3d" listen="pop3" prefork=0

and /etc/imapd.conf includes the following:

  enable_pop: yes
  pop_auth_clear: yes

I HUPed the cyrus master process and got the following error:

master[17859]: unable to create pop3 listener socket: Permission denied

The permissions on the /var/imap/socket directory appear to be correct:

  drwxr-xr-x 8 cyrusimap mail

Am I missing something?
